Yes, you can paint laminate kitchen cabinets. However, since this surface is non-porous, it might be a bit more difficult for the paint to adhere properly. But here are some steps you can try to make sure that paint adheres to the furniture surface. • Initially, check to see if the cabinet is still in great condition. Sand the Cabinets. For smooth priming and painting, it’s crucial to sand your laminate kitchen cabinets correctly. Start by using medium-grit sandpaper to remove any dirt or grime. You can opt for 120–180 grit sandpaper. You can either do this by hand or use a sander, whichever works for you. Table of Contents. 4 Stages of Updating Your Kitchen Laminate Cabinet. If you have flat doors on your kitchen cabinets, you can quickly apply paint by using a roller with a 1/4-inch nap (for a ...After you've removed the laminate, there is bound to be some residual glue. Scrape off as much as you can using a solvent, such as paint thinner or acetone, to soften it. Use the solvent to rub off whatever you can't scrape off. You can also use 120-grit sandpaper for removing glue from MDF cabinets.

However, you can also paint metal or laminate cabinets. Most cabinets are usually painted or stained. Test for an oil-based or water-based paint in a shadowed corner: If a cotton ball dipped in rubbing alcohol removes some paint, it's latex. If not, it's oil paint. You can paint over latex, sand it or strip it down to start fresh. Empty the cabinets, clear the counters, and move furniture that’s in the way so you have plenty of work space. Give the room a thorough dusting to prevent particles such as pollen from settling on the wet paint.
